Fire Crews Tackle Early Morning Blaze At Laundrette

Firefighters have tackled a blaze at a laundrette in Keynsham in the early hours of yesterday morning, thought to have been caused by overheating washing.

Avon Fire & Rescue were called to Queen’s Road in Keynsham just after 7am.

When crews arrived they found a fire in the premises so two firefighters wearing breathing apparatus used a high pressure hose reel to put the blaze out.

It’s thought the fire started accidentally after washing dried and tightly packed into a bag the previous night had overheated and caught fire.

The fire caused smoke damage to the premises.
